在现代信息技术的发展中,服务器和主机是两个常常被提及的术语。尽管它们在某些情况下可以互换使用,但实际上,它们在功能、结构和应用场景上有着显著的区别。本文将对服务器和主机进行深入解析,帮助读者更好地理解这两个重要概念。
一、定义解析
服务器是指提供数据、服务或资源给其他计算机和设备的专业计算机系统。它通常具有强大的处理能力、较大的存储容量和高带宽,以满足大量用户的访问请求。服务器的功能包括存储数据、运行应用程序、管理网络流量等。
而主机是指连接到网络的任何计算机或设备,能够在网络中进行数据传输和信息交换。主机可以是个人电脑、笔记本电脑、智能手机,甚至是某些嵌入式设备。
二、功能与角色
1. 服务器的功能
- 数据存储与管理:服务器负责存储和管理大量数据,确保用户能够快速、安全地访问信息。
- 资源共享:多个用户可以通过服务器访问共享的资源如文件、打印机和应用程序。
- 处理请求:服务器通过处理来自客户端的请求,执行特定的任务,如数据库查询、网页加载等。
2. 主机的角色
- 客户端:大多数主机在网络中扮演客户端的角色,发起请求以获取数据或服务。
- 信息展示:主机通常是用户查看和互动信息的界面,通过网络连接到服务器获取所需的内容。
服务器与主机的区别主要在于它们在网络中的作用及承担的任务。
三、结构与性能
1. 服务器的硬件配置
服务器的硬件配置通常比主机更为复杂、高端。它们使用高性能的CPU、大容量的内存、冗余的电源和冷却系统,以确保稳定性和可靠性。例如,企业级服务器常常运行多个处理器,并搭载高达数TB的存储空间,从而支持大型应用和数据库的运行。
2. 主机的硬件配置
相对而言,主机的硬件配置则可以更为灵活。不论是普通消费者使用的台式电脑,还是笔记本电脑,它们通常更关注性价比,配置可能包括中等性能的CPU和适量的内存。在普通使用情况下,这些配置足以满足日常办公、娱乐等需要。
四、操作系统
服务器和主机在所使用的操作系统方面也有所不同。大多数服务器会运行专门的服务器操作系统,如Windows Server、Linux等,这些系统更加强调安全性、稳定性和高效的网络管理能力。而主机则常用的操作系统包括Windows、macOS、Linux等,注重的是用户体验和多媒体处理能力。
五、用途与应用场景
1. 服务器的用途
- 网站托管:许多企业使用服务器来托管网站,保证用户能够随时访问。
- 数据中心:在云计算和大数据时代,数据中心也由成千上万台服务器组成,提供云服务、大数据分析等功能。
- 企业应用:如ERP、CRM等系统往往部署在服务器上,实现高效的企业资源管理。
2. 主机的应用场景
- 日常办公:个人电脑或笔记本是日常办公和学习的理想选择,便于操作和携带。
- 娱乐消遣:主机也是娱乐用途,如玩游戏、观看视频等,提供了丰富的多媒体体验。
- 开发环境:开发者使用主机来开发和测试小型应用,以及进行学习和研究。
六、网络连接
在网络连接方面,服务器通常会配置静态IP地址,以确保其在网络中地址不变,方便其他设备访问。而主机则多使用动态IP地址,尤其是在家庭和小型办公室环境中,设备的IP地址可能会频繁变化。
七、安全性
由于服务器通常处理大量的敏感数据,安全性要求非常高。因此,在服务器上会实施严格的安全措施,如防火墙、VPN、数据加密等。而主机一般面临的安全威胁较少,用户可以根据需要进行相应的安全配置。
结语
从以上几个方面来看,服务器与主机在功能、性能、用途等方面都存在着明显的区别。了解这些区别,有助于用户根据自身需求选择合适的设备和服务。当需要处理大量数据、用户请求或托管网站时,选择服务器无疑是更为明智的决定。而对于日常使用或小型项目,主机则足以满足要求。